AsyncEnumerable.ToAsyncEnumerable<TSource> Method

Converts an IEnumerable<T> to an IAsyncEnumerable<T>.
public:
generic <typename TSource>
[System::Runtime::CompilerServices::Extension]
static System::Collections::Generic::IAsyncEnumerable<TSource> ^ ToAsyncEnumerable(System::Collections::Generic::IEnumerable<TSource> ^ source);
public static System.Collections.Generic.IAsyncEnumerable<TSource> ToAsyncEnumerable<TSource>(this System.Collections.Generic.IEnumerable<TSource> source);
static member ToAsyncEnumerable : seq<'Source> -> System.Collections.Generic.IAsyncEnumerable<'Source>
<Extension()>
Public Function ToAsyncEnumerable(Of TSource) (source As IEnumerable(Of TSource)) As IAsyncEnumerable(Of TSource)
Type Parameters
- TSource
The type of the elements of source.
Parameters
- source
- IEnumerable<TSource>
An IEnumerable<T> of the elements to enumerate.
Returns
An IAsyncEnumerable<T> containing the sequence of elements from source.
Exceptions
source is null.
Remarks
If source already implements IAsyncEnumerable<T>, it is returned directly. Otherwise, each iteration through the resulting IAsyncEnumerable<T> will iterate through the source.
